The Nutritional Importance of Food

Food is essential for survival. The nutrients we obtain from the food we eat are the building
blocks of our bodies, enabling us to grow, maintain energy, and fight illness. There are six
primary types of nutrients: carbohydrates, proteins, fats, vitamins, minerals, and water. Each
plays a crucial role in maintaining our health and well-being.

Carbohydrates are the body’s primary source of energy. Found in foods like bread, pasta,
rice, and fruits, carbohydrates are broken down into glucose, which the body uses for fuel.
Complex carbohydrates, such as those found in whole grains and vegetables, provide a
slower, more sustained energy release.

Proteins are necessary for growth, tissue repair, and the production of enzymes and
hormones. Foods rich in protein include meat, fish, eggs, beans, and nuts. For those
following plant-based diets, legumes, tofu, and quinoa are excellent sources.


Fats are essential for brain function, cell structure, and the absorption of certain vitamins.

Healthy fats can be found in avocados, olive oil, nuts, and fatty fish like salmon. Trans fats
and excessive saturated fats should be limited to reduce the risk of heart disease.

Vitamins and minerals are essential for various bodily functions, including immune support,
bone health, and energy production. Fruits, vegetables, dairy, and meat are rich in vitamins
and minerals, such as Vitamin C, calcium, iron, and potassium.

Water is the most critical nutrient of all. It regulates body temperature, aids digestion, and
helps eliminate waste. Staying hydrated is vital for maintaining proper bodily functions.
A balanced diet, rich in these nutrients, ensures that we stay healthy and energized
throughout the day. The variety of foods available globally allows for diverse ways of meeting
our nutritional needs while also satisfying our taste buds.


Food and Culture: A Symbol of Identity

Food is deeply intertwined with culture. The ingredients we use, the way we prepare meals,
and the traditions surrounding food all reflect our cultural heritage. Every cuisine tells a
unique story, shaped by geography, history, and local resources. For example, Italian cuisine
is known for its use of fresh vegetables, olive oil, and herbs, while Japanese cuisine
emphasizes rice, seafood, and a balance of flavors like salty, sweet, and sour.


The role of food in cultural practices extends beyond daily meals. Festivals, celebrations,
and rituals often feature special foods that carry symbolic meaning. In India, for example,
food is an integral part of religious ceremonies, with offerings of fruit, sweets, and spices
made to deities. Similarly, in many Western countries, Thanksgiving is marked by a large
feast centered around turkey, symbolizing abundance and gratitude.

Food also plays a central role in family and social gatherings. In many cultures, mealtime is
a time for families and friends to come together, share stories, and strengthen bonds.
Whether it’s a communal potluck, a festive banquet, or a casual dinner, food serves as a
medium for connection and expression. For instance, the Mexican tradition of sharing a
hearty meal like tacos or enchiladas brings people together to celebrate life and community.


The Evolution of Global Cuisine

Over the centuries, the world’s cuisines have evolved and merged, creating a rich tapestry of
flavors and culinary techniques. The movement of people, goods, and ideas has resulted in
the exchange of ingredients and cooking methods across borders, leading to the global
spread of food. This phenomenon, often referred to as food globalization, has resulted in an
incredible diversity of flavors, from sushi in Japan to burgers in the United States, to curries
in India.

The rise of international travel and the increasing availability of exotic ingredients have made
it easier than ever to experiment with new cuisines. For example, dishes like pizza, originally
from Italy, are now enjoyed by people worldwide, and Chinese takeout is a staple in many
countries. Similarly, the popularity of fusion cuisine, which blends elements of different
culinary traditions, has sparked creativity in kitchens around the world.

However, globalization has not come without its challenges. The spread of Western fast food
chains has raised concerns about the impact on local food traditions and health. The global
rise of processed foods, high in sugar, salt, and unhealthy fats, has contributed to the
growing obesity epidemic and other lifestyle diseases. This has led to a renewed interest in
preserving traditional diets and promoting healthier eating habits.

The Cultural Significance of Food

Food is deeply rooted in culture, offering insights into a community’s history, traditions, and
beliefs. Every region in the world has its own unique cuisine, which has evolved over
centuries. For example, Italian cuisine is known for its pasta, pizza, and olive oil, while
Japanese cuisine emphasizes fresh fish, rice, and delicate presentation. Each dish is a
representation of the resources available in the region, the climate, and the history of the
people who created it.

One of the most powerful aspects of food is its ability to connect people. Sharing a meal is
often seen as a symbol of community and belonging. In many cultures, food plays a central
role in social gatherings, festivals, and ceremonies. Thanksgiving dinner in the United
States, for instance, is a time for families and friends to come together and share a meal,
symbolizing gratitude and togetherness. Similarly, the Japanese tea ceremony revolves
around the preparation and consumption of matcha tea, reflecting values of respect,
mindfulness, and harmony.

Food can also serve as a medium for cultural exchange. As people travel and migrate, they
bring their culinary traditions with them, enriching the food landscapes of the places they
settle. This exchange has given rise to fusion cuisines, such as Tex-Mex, which combines
elements of Mexican and American cooking, or the vibrant Indian-Chinese dishes found in
many parts of India. The globalization of food has made the world more interconnected and
has allowed people to experience flavors and ingredients from different cultures without
leaving their homes.


The Role of Food in Health

Food is the primary source of the nutrients our bodies need to function properly. A
well-balanced diet, rich in vitamins, minerals, and other essential nutrients, supports overall
health, boosts the immune system, and provides energy. However, the relationship between
food and health is complex. While certain foods promote health, others can contribute to
diseases if consumed in excess.

A nutritious diet typically includes a variety of whole foods, such as fruits, vegetables, whole
gr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. These foods provide a wide range of nutrients that
the body requires for growth, repair, and maintenance. For example, fruits and vegetables
are rich in antioxidants, which help combat free radicals that can damage cells and
contribute to aging and diseases like cancer. Whole grains, on the other hand, provide fiber,
which supports digestive health and helps regulate blood sugar levels.


In contrast, diets high in processed foods, sugars, and unhealthy fats can lead to a variety of
health problems, including obesity, heart disease, and diabetes. Many modern diets,
especially in Western countries, are dominated by fast food and sugary snacks, which are
often low in nutrients but high in calories. These foods may provide temporary satisfaction
but can have long-term negative effects on health.

The rise of plant-based diets in recent years is an example of a growing awareness of the
importance of food choices for health. A plant-based diet, which focuses on fruits,
vegetables, legumes, and grains while minimizing animal products, has been associated
with lower risks of heart disease, cancer, and diabetes. It also has environmental benefits, as
plant-based foods generally require fewer resources and produce fewer greenhouse gases
compared to animal-based foods.

The History of Street Food: A Culinary Journey

Street food is more than just a quick bite—it’s a cultural experience that reflects the traditions, history, and flavors of a region. From the bustling night markets of Asia to the taco stands of Mexico, street food has been a vital part of human civilization for centuries.
In this article, we’ll explore the origins of street food, its evolution, and how it continues to shape the global food scene today.


1. rayap 169 of Street Food
Street food has existed since ancient times, providing affordable and convenient meals for people on the go.
🏺 Ancient Civilizations
Ancient Egypt – Archaeologists found evidence of food stalls selling bread and grilled meat in Thebes.
Ancient Greece & Rome – Vendors sold fried fish, bread, and stews in busy marketplaces.
China (Song Dynasty, 10th-13th Century) – Street vendors offered dumplings, noodles, and skewered meats.
Street food was especially popular among the working class, who often didn’t have kitchens at home.
